Rabbit polyclonal BAD antibody
Purification
BAD antibody was purified by immunoaffinity chromatography.
Immunogen
BAD antibody was raised in Rabbit using the peptide sequence around phosphorylation site of serine136 (S-R-S(p)-A-P) derived from Mouse BAD as the immunogen.

Storage Comment
Store at 4 deg C for short term storage. Aliquot and store at -20 deg C for long term storage. Avoid repeated freeze/thaw cycles.
